Battery Problems

Battery problems are a common issue with the Kwikset Powerbolt 250. Users often encounter issues like dead batteries, short battery life, or difficulty in replacing the batteries. Addressing these problems can ensure your lock functions smoothly and reliably.

Replacing The Batteries

First, locate the battery cover on the interior side of the lock. Slide the cover upwards to remove it. This will expose the battery compartment. Carefully remove the old batteries and dispose of them properly. Insert new AA batteries, ensuring correct polarity. Replace the battery cover by sliding it back into place. Your lock should now be operational.

Battery Life Tips

Opt for high-quality AA alkaline batteries for longer life. Cheap batteries may not last as long. Check for corrosion on the battery contacts. Clean the contacts with a dry cloth if needed. Minimize lock usage to extend battery life. Frequent locking and unlocking can drain batteries faster. Regularly check battery levels and replace them before they die.

Resetting The Lock

Resetting the Kwikset Powerbolt 250 may help if it is not responding. To perform a reset, follow these simple steps:

First, remove the battery cover and take out the batteries. Press and hold the program button while reinserting the batteries. Hold the button for about 30 seconds. Release the button, then press it again briefly. Your lock should now be reset.

Motor Issues

The Kwikset Powerbolt 250 is a reliable electronic lock. Yet, sometimes the motor can face issues. These motor problems can prevent the lock from working properly. Here, we will explore how to identify and fix motor issues.

Identifying Motor Problems

First, listen for unusual sounds. A grinding noise can indicate a motor issue. Check if the motor moves the bolt smoothly. If the bolt gets stuck, the motor might be failing. Observe the motor’s response when you enter the code. A slow or weak response can signal a problem.

Next, inspect the battery. Weak batteries can affect motor performance. Replace the batteries to see if the motor works better. Look for visible damage on the motor. Cracks or wear can cause motor problems. Also, check if the motor wiring is intact. Damaged wires can interrupt the motor’s function.

Lubricating The Motor

Lubrication can help resolve motor issues. Use a silicone-based lubricant. Avoid using oil-based lubricants. They can attract dust and debris. Apply the lubricant to the motor gears. This reduces friction and helps the motor run smoothly.

Ensure the lubricant covers all moving parts. Work the lock several times after applying. This helps distribute the lubricant evenly. Regular lubrication can prevent future motor issues. Keep a maintenance routine to ensure the motor stays in good condition.

Mechanical Problems

Mechanical problems with the Kwikset Powerbolt 250 can be frustrating. These issues might hinder the lock’s performance. Let’s explore some common mechanical problems and how to address them.

Inspecting The Deadbolt

The deadbolt is a critical part of the lock. Check if it moves smoothly. If it sticks, debris might be causing the issue. Clean the deadbolt area gently. Sometimes, the lock’s mechanism may need lubrication. Use a dry lubricant for this task.

Next, test the lock by turning the key. If the deadbolt still sticks, it may be misaligned. Misalignment can cause the deadbolt to jam. To fix this, you might need to adjust the lock.

Aligning The Strike Plate

The strike plate aligns with the deadbolt. If misaligned, it can cause problems. First, close the door and mark where the deadbolt hits the strike plate. Open the door and check the mark’s position.

If the mark is off-center, adjust the strike plate. Loosen the screws and move the plate slightly. Tighten the screws and test the lock again. Repeat if necessary until the deadbolt aligns perfectly.
